  • Patent number: 11053928
    Abstract: This assembly comprises a cup containing a thermally-expandable material, a piston designed to move in translation along an axis (X-X) under the action of the thermally-expandable material, a guide (40) for guiding the piston and intended to be fixed to the cup, and a buffer (60) made of an elastomer material and designed to be interposed between the thermally-expandable material and the piston. The guide is provided with a bore (41) that is intended to be centered on the axis and comprises a first bore portion (41.2) having a constant cross-section, a second bore portion (41.1) provided to receive the piston and having a cross-section that is both constant and smaller than that of the first bore portion, and a third bore portion (41.3) that continuously connects the first and second bore portions.
